What affects the price

When you hire an accident lawyer, fees usually depend on the complexity of your case. Factors that move the needle include the severity of your injuries, the amount of property damage, and how clearly the other driver is at fault. Cases involving multiple vehicles or disputed police reports often require more investigation, which can impact the final agreement. Most attorneys work on a contingency basis, meaning they take a percentage of the settlement rather than an upfront fee. While contingency rates typically range from 33% to 40% depending on whether a trial is necessary, ex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

About this service

A truck accident lawyer focuses specifically on collisions involving semi-trucks, tractor-trailers, and delivery vehicles. You need this service because these accidents often result in catastrophic injuries due to the sheer size and weight of the vehicles involved. These lawyers are experts at navigating the complex web of state and federal trucking laws. They work to preserve evidence, such as black box data, that trucking companies might otherwise destroy, ensuring that all parties responsible for your safety are held accountable.

What evidence helps a truck accident case in Brownsville?

Key evidence includes the police report, photographs of the accident scene and vehicles, witness statements, and any data from the truck's "black box." For truck accidents, driver logs, maintenance records, and delivery manifests are also crucial. The pros will guide you in gathering all necessary documentation for your Brownsville case.
